B. Madhusoodhana Kurup

Prof. B. Madhusoodana Kurup, is an Indian Professor and a fishery scientist, is the founding Vice Chancellor of Kerala University of Fisheries and Ocean Studies (KUFOS), effective 1 March 2011. Formerly he was the Director of School of Industrial Fisheries of Cochin University of Science & Technology (CUSAT).[1] KUFOS is the first stand-alone university of its kind in India with its headquarters at the former campus of the College of Fisheries of the Kerala Agricultural University.

Prof. Kurup has over 34 years of research and 30 years of teaching experience in Cochin University of Science & Technology and Kerala Agricultural University. He served as Associate and Assistant professor in Kerala Agricultural University, Professor in CUSAT for more than 12 years and Director of School of Industrial Fisheries from October 2008 to February 2011. Prof. Kurup also served as technical adviser to Minister for Fisheries, Government of Kerala during 2006 - 2011 in the rank of Govt. Secretary.

Prof. Kurup received a master's degree in Marine Biology from Cochin University of Science & Technology, and a PhD in Fisheries Sciences, from the same institution.
